In this lecture on Bhagavad-Gita, Swami plumbs the topic of faith. After discussing the three types of material faith, he emphasizes the necessity of establishing faith in the realm of suddha-sattva (pure goodness) and clarifies how this is accomplished. Citing Sri Rupa, he then delineates the stages of transcendental faith. He ends with the recommendation that we assess others according to their potential, explaining how this generous vision will help both ourselves and others.
